(Wonju=Yonhap News) Reporter Lee Jae-hyun = The 30th National Farmers' Day Ceremony will be held in Wonju on November 11.

Wonju Mayor Won Gang-su stated in a press briefing on the 1st, "It is a very symbolic and meaningful decision that the National Ceremony for Farmers' Day is being held in Wonju, the birthplace of the holiday."

He continued, "The confirmation of this ceremony is a reflection of the historical significance and the necessity of the event that Wonju City has been emphasizing all along. We will thoroughly prepare so that the National Ceremony for Farmers' Day can become a successful national event that everyone participates in."

He also vowed, "We will not remain confined to achievements in the agricultural sector alone, but will vigorously advance as a central hub for all industries."

The date of November 11 for Farmers' Day was chosen because the Chinese character for ten (十) plus the character for one (一) equals the character for soil (土).

It embodies the meaning of being born from the soil, living in the soil, and returning to the soil.

The initial origin of Farmers' Day is in Wonju.

The origin dates back to 1964 when the Nongsa Improvement Club (now the Wonju Rural Leaders Association) in Wonseong County, Gangwon Province, held the "1st Wonseong County Farmers' Day" at the Wonseong County Farmers' Association building at 11 AM on November 11, based on the "Three Soils Philosophy" that "people are born from the soil, live in the soil, and return to the soil."

The city continuously proposed to the government from 1980 to 1995 to designate it as a legal memorial day, and played a very important role in the designation of Farmers' Day as a national memorial day in 1996.
